The Pursuit of Guardiola and Other Rejections
Italy had initially set their sights on securing the services of Pep Guardiola, the highly successful manager of Manchester City. The Italian Football Federation was keen on bringing Guardiola to Coverciano and granting him full autonomy in devising a strategy to revamp the Azzurri national teams. However, their efforts were thwarted as Guardiola declined the offer, opting to stay with Manchester City.
In addition to Guardiola’s rejection, another prominent name that turned down the opportunity was Carlo Ancelotti, who chose to fulfill his contract with the Brazilian Football Federation until 2030. These setbacks led the Italian Football Federation to shift their focus towards other candidates, eventually settling on Andrea Pirlo as their choice to lead the national team.
